Half marathons come in all shapes and sizes (although they are all the same length much to the surprise of your non-runner friends). There are half marathons that send runners straight up the side of a mountain, half marathons that are 13 laps around the same pond, and half marathons that are run through the desert in the middle of the night. With hundreds of halfs run each year in the United States alone, there’s an option for just about everyone no matter the season, location, or terrain you’d like to run in.

While there are certainly plenty of runners who seek out difficult half marathons (because who doesn’t love a challenge?), there’s something to be said for a flat and fast half marathon. A course without too many hills is easier to train for—especially if you’re a half marathon newbie—requires less race-day strategy, and yields more personal records. Whereas a hilly course could leave you walking up an incline at mile 12, a flat course delivers runners less surprises. And if you are looking to nab a new PR, a flat course is a great place to nab it.

So which half marathons offer flat and fast courses? We’re so glad you asked. Here are 12 half marathon courses without too many hills so that you can earn a brand new PR without hurting your knees on a steep downhill in the process.

    While California may be hilly, sticking to the coast is usually a recipe for a flat and fast race. The Surf City Half Marathon, which is run in Huntington Beach, south of Los Angeles, spends most of its time on the Pacific Coast Highway along the ocean. Starting and ending near the famous Huntington Beach Pier, runners will be able to see the beach for most of the course, aside from one detour further inland around Mile 3. The out-and-back nature of the course also means you’ll know exactly what to expect in the race’s final miles because you’ll have already run them.

    There’s nothing quite like a cold, refreshing beer after a long run, and there’s nowhere better to grab a brewsky than in Milwaukee, Wisconsin. The Brew City Half Marathon mostly traces the Milwaukee River in an out-and-back course through the parks that line the river’s banks. With a total elevation gain of less than 600 feet, the course is mostly flat. Plus, the uphill portion of the race is on the front end, which means you’ll be cruising to the finish on a nice downhill, where of course beers will be waiting.

        The Pacific Coast Running Festival is most famous for its Sand Marathon. Yes, that is a marathon run on the beach. While running on sand does have some health benefits, speed certainly isn’t one of them. The festival’s half marathon, however, is run on a flat, paved bike path that also runs along the edge of the Pacific Ocean. That means the course is beach flat without you having to run in the beach sand. Whether you run the half or the full, however, you deserve a big ole bowl of clam chowder once you finish.

            The Boston Marathon is famous for being a difficult course (They don’t call it Heartbreak Hill for nothing!), but another of Massachusetts marathons has such a flat course that 28 percent of its runners have qualified for Boston two years in a row. While the half marathon won’t qualify you for Boston, it is also pretty flat as it sends runners on a loop along the Merrimack River. Located north of Boston near the New Hampshire border, the race typically gives runners a chance to catch the beautiful foliage as the leaves change colors each autumn. If you’ve been wanting to drive around New England to see the colors, why not get a PR while you’re at it.

                  For some, running a half marathon 10 days before Christmas might be a bit overwhelming. For others, it’s the perfect excuse to blow off some steam. The Mississippi Gulf Coast Half, which is run along the Gulf of Mexico in Biloxi, Mississippi, is flat as a pancake and provides runners with plenty of sea breezes to keep them cool. It’s the perfect way to cap a great year or get the good energy started for a new one, plus a race expo is a fantastic place to buy some Christmas gifts.
